It is an unlikely place for an eatery of any sort, but if you were going to pick a restaurant to open up on this little strand at the end of Lake June Road, it would probably be a taco place. Lucky for you, Barbacoa Estilo Hidalgo isn't just any taco restaurant, but a really good one. They likely make the best barbacoa in all of Dallas, and they pack it into handmade tortillas. Owner Raymundo Sanchez roasts lamb down to shreds on the weekends for breakfast and lunch. During the week his restaurant is closed. That's just as well because the food here was designed to destroy your worst hangover. The lamb roasts in a special oven, suspended over a bed of chickpeas. What collects in a pan at the bottom is the most restorative soup you'll ever encounter. Come with friends and say goodbye to last night's margarita haze. Everything is all right now.
